A fiber optic pigtail is a short optical fiber cable that has a connector on one end and an exposed (unterminated) fiber on the other. The connector end plugs into devices like transceivers or patch
Duplex fiber optic pigtail has two fibers and two connectors on one end. Each fiber is marked “A”or “B" or different colored connector boots are used to mark polarity.
